Namibia gained independence from South Africa in 1990. It is about the size of California but not so many people — about 2.5 million. A former German colony, the country speaks German, English, Afrikaans and a dozen or more African languages. Twenty five percent of it is a windswept sandy desert that runs right to the ocean. The people brag about their high quality seafood from the nutrient rich currents and are proud of their hundreds of bird species that migrate through the area. The land was once famous for diamonds but no longer. I took the included tour to one of the highest sand dunes in the region and a beach known for flamingos and jellyfish.

When we got out to Dune Seven, we were surprised to see that Viking beat us out there and set up cold drinks and snacks. They are amazing!

When we got back to the ship the pavement between the bus and the gangway was covered in cardboard and towels. There was a layer of coal dust covering every inch of the dock due to wind blown coal dust from the mountains of coal in the port area. What a mess. It will take a while to clean carpets on the ship
